Artwork Description

Oil on canvas, ready to hang.

Signed on the front.

A man and woman sit on a verandah by the sea - she lost in contemplation, he scanning the horizon through binoculars. The painting is done in a stylised and expressive way, with realistic details that are not realistic at all, despite the attention to detail, and that is the whole point of this painting -- something to look at and wonder about, rather than a mirror held up to reality. The viewer is free to use their own imagination and create their own story about what is going on here.
